Rabu, 23 April 2014

MULTIPROSESSING SIMETRIS DAN ASIMETRIS

1.      Jelaskan perbedaan antara multiprocessing simeis dan asimetris ?
Jawab:
Multiprocessing simetris adalah computer stand alone dengan krakteristik berikut :
*      Dua atau lebih prosessor yang sama dengan kapasitas yang sebanding.
*      Prosessor membagi  I/O dan memori  yang sama.
*      Prosessor terkoneksi oleh bus  atau koneksi internal lainnya.
*      Waktu mengakses memori kira-kira sama pada setiap prosessor.
*      Seluruh prosessor membagi I/O baik pada chanel yang sama atau berbeda dengan memberika path pada device yang sama.
*      Seluruh prosessor mengerjakan fungsi yang sama
*      Sistem dikontrol oleh OS yang terintegraksi menyeiakan interaksi antara prosesso  atau iteraksi terjadi pada job,task,file,data pada elemen-elemen
*      SMP merupakan Tightly Couplet System
*      Mempunyai lebih dari  satu proses
*      Dapat berkomunikasi
*      Membagi bus.clock,perangkat memori dan peripheral
*      Setiap prosessor menjalankan system operasi yang identik dan komunikasi antara prosessor  jika  diperlukan .
Sedangkan asimetris adalah pendekatan pertama untuk multiprosessor scheduling adalah asymmetric multiprosessing scheduling atau biasa disebut juga sebagai penjadwalan master slave multiprosessor.Dimana pada metode ini satu prosessor bertindak sebagai master dan prosessor lain bertindak sebagai slave.
2.      Jelaskan yang dimaksud dengan terdistribusi,real time system,time sharing system dan multiprogramming
Jawab:
Ø  Terdistribusi adalah dimana computer hardware atau software nya terletak dalam suatu jaringan computer yang saling berkomunikasi dan berkoordinasi menggunaan message pasing.
Ø  Real time system adalah system yang kebenarannya secara logis didasarkan pada kebenaran hasil-hasil keluaran system dan ketepatan waktu hasil-hasil tersebut dikeluarkan.
Ø  Time  sharing system adalah pengembangan dari system multiprogram.job yang berada pada memori utama dieksekusi oleh CPU.CPU hanya isa menjalankan program yang ada pada memori utama.perpindahan anta job sangat sering terjadi sehingga user dapat berinteraksi dengan setiap program pada saat dijalankan.

Ø  Multiprogramming adalah kegiatan menjalankan beberapa program pada memori pada satu waktu.untuk meningkatkan keseluruhan kemampuan dari system computer,para developer memperkenalkan konsep multiprogramming.dengan multiprogramming,beberapa tugas disimpan pada satu memori pada satu waktu.CPU digunakan secara bergantian sehingga menambah utilisasi CPU dan mengurangi total waktu yang dibutuhkan untuk menyelesaikan tugas-tugas tersebut.

Tidak ada komentar:

Posting Komentar